While birds are a natural part of the environment, urban pest birds like pigeons and gulls can cause extensive structural damage and create severe health hazards when they flock to buildings. Their highly acidic droppings can rapidly corrode roofing materials, metal facades, and solar panels, leading to costly facility repairs. Furthermore, accumulated bird guano and nesting materials can harbor dangerous airborne pathogens, such as Histoplasmosis and Cryptococcosis, while introducing secondary pests like bird mites into your indoor spaces, making proactive control a critical priority.
The most successful approach to bird control relies on humane, physical exclusion and structural deterrents rather than harmful eradication. Because birds possess a strong homing instinct, simply cleaning up nests is a temporary fix; you must make the architecture itself unappealing for roosting. Installing specialized UV-stabilized anti-bird netting, discreet stainless steel bird spikes on building ledges, and harmless electrified track systems are highly effective methods to permanently block access to their preferred perches. By addressing these vulnerabilities, facility managers can successfully deter pest birds without causing them harm, ensuring strict compliance with local wildlife protection regulations.
